†Malacanthus carosii Carnevale 2016 (ray-finned fish)

Osteichthyes - Acanthopterygii - Malacanthidae
Full reference: G. Carnevale. 2016. Blanquillos (Teleostei, Malacanthidae) from the Middle Miocene of St. Margarethen in Burgenland, Austria: Palaeoenvironmental implications. Annales de Paléontologie 102:51-57
Belongs to Malacanthus according to G. Carnevale 2016
Sister taxon: Malacanthus sulcatum
Type specimen: NHMW 1976/1837/79a + b,, a skeleton. Its type locality is Kummer Quarry, which is in a Langhian shallow subtidal limestone in the Leitha Formation of Austria.
Ecology: planktonic suspension feeder
Distribution: found only at Kummer Quarry
